    agronomics. ( ˌæɡrəˈnɒmɪks) n. (Economics) ( functioning as singular) the branch of economics dealing with the distribution, management, and productivity of land. ˌagroˈnomic, ˌagroˈnomical adj. ˌagroˈnomically adv.
